HubSpot Sales Hub stands out for unifying lead management, email outreach, and sales automation inside a CRM-first workflow. It delivers sequences for multi-step outreach, call and meeting scheduling, and sales automation tied to CRM records and pipelines. The platform also connects email tracking, contact engagement history, and deal context so reps can personalize follow-ups. Sales analytics and activity reporting close the loop across sequences, meetings, and deal stages.

Leadfeeder’s distinct angle is converting website visitor data into lead signals without requiring direct lead capture forms on every page. It tracks anonymous and known visitors, maps them to companies and job roles, and highlights which accounts are actively engaging. Core workflows focus on lead alerts, contact/company enrichment signals, and CRM handoff for sales follow-up. It is best suited to teams that want account-based lead intelligence driven by onsite behavior.

What Is Sales Lead Software?
Sales lead software helps teams find prospects, enrich lead and company records, and manage outreach actions so leads progress into an accountable sales pipeline. It also centralizes follow-up work such as tasks, email tracking, and engagement context tied to contacts and deals. Tools like HubSpot Sales Hub combine lead management with CRM-based sequences and meeting scheduling. Tools like Apollo combine lead sourcing, contact enrichment, and multistep outreach tracking in a single workspace.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Common buying failures come from mismatched workflow center, insufficient engagement visibility, and enrichment that does not align with pipeline and identity needs.
Buying outreach automation without CRM-linked engagement and next-step context
Sales teams that want outreach-driven pipeline progress should prioritize HubSpot Sales Hub because sequences tie to CRM records and provide analytics across sequences, meetings, and deal stages. Teams that choose tools without that linkage often struggle to connect email outcomes to pipeline next steps.
Relying on enrichment coverage without a plan for identity resolution and data hygiene
People Data Labs reduces misrouting by matching people to the right company records through entity resolution. Clearbit and ZoomInfo enrichments still depend on mapping and governance because coverage gaps or missing fields can limit usefulness when enriched data is incomplete.
Confusing social outreach automation for pipeline management
Waalaxy automates LinkedIn prospecting and outreach sequences with connection and follow-up steps, but it has limited visibility for multi-stage pipeline tracking. Teams that need deep pipeline modeling should use HubSpot Sales Hub or Pipedrive instead of expecting Waalaxy to manage deal progression.
Overloading complex workflow automation without implementation discipline
Zoho CRM’s powerful Blueprint automation and Zoho ecosystem extensibility can increase setup complexity when workflow conditions are advanced. Pipedrive automation rules can clutter workflows if triggers are not tuned, so clear process ownership prevents noisy task generation.
